Peripheral Setup

Peripheral Setup

The Peripheral Setup menu displays the connection locations between the system and the Input/Output (I/O) ports and lets you specify different port assignments as needed.

Peripheral Setup

Parameter

Default Setting

Alternate Setting(s)

USB Controller

Disabled

Enabled

AC’97 Audio

Enabled

Disabled

Internal Hard Drive

Enabled

Disabled

Serial Port

Auto

Disabled/(PnP OS Setup1)

 

 

COM1,IRQ4/COM2,IRQ3

 

 

COM3,IRQ4/COM4,IRQ3

Parallel Port

Auto

Disabled/LPT1/LPT2

 

 

(PnP OS Setup1)

Parallel Mode

Bi-Directional

Uni-Directional/ECP/EPP

IR Serial Port

Disabled

Auto/(PnP OS Setup1)

 

 

COM2,IRQ3/COM3,IRQ4/

 

 

COM4,IRQ3

1Appears only when configured by the Windows 98 or Windows 95 device manager.

Peripheral Setup allows you to define the following functions.

!USB Controller — Enables or disables the USB controller.

!AC’97 Audio — Enables or disables the internal sound.

!Internal Hard Drive — Enables or disables the internal hard drive.

!Serial Port — Disables the port or changes its address assignment.

!Parallel Port/Parallel Mode — Disables or reassigns the parallel port and select a parallel port mode.

!IR Serial Port — Enables, disables, or reassigns the IR serial port.
